Overview

Hanzo KV is a Redis-compatible in-memory key-value store used as the caching, streaming, and message broker layer across the Hanzo ecosystem. C codebase built with CMake, ships as ghcr.io/hanzoai/kv. Includes a native ZAP binary protocol module for high-throughput access. Default port 6379 (RESP), ZAP port 9653. License: BSD-3-Clause.

Why Hanzo KV?

  • Redis drop-in replacement: Any Redis client works out of the box
  • ZAP binary protocol: Native module on port 9653 (17x faster than JSON-RPC)
  • Persistence: RDB snapshots and AOF for durability
  • Replication: Primary-replica with Sentinel automatic failover
  • Cluster mode: Horizontal scaling with automatic sharding
  • Module system: Extensible via C module API (kvmodule.h)

ZAP Binary Protocol

The ZAP module (modules/zap/) implements the luxfi/zap binary protocol natively:

# Load module at startup
kv-server --loadmodule /path/to/zap.so PORT 9653

ZAP endpoints:

PathBodyDescription
/get{"key":"mykey"}GET a key
/set{"key":"mykey","value":"myval"}SET a key
/del{"key":"mykey"}DEL a key
/cmd{"cmd":"PING","args":[]}Execute any command

Module API

Custom modules use the KV Module API:

#include "kvmodule.h"

int KVModule_OnLoad(KVModuleCtx *ctx, KVModuleString **argv, int argc) {
    if (KVModule_Init(ctx, "mymod", 1, KVMODULE_APIVER_1) == KVMODULE_ERR)
        return KVMODULE_ERR;
    // register commands...
    return KVMODULE_OK;
}

Configuration

# Pass config file
kv-server /etc/kv/kv.conf

# Or command-line options
kv-server --port 6379 --maxmemory 256mb --appendonly yes

Docker default CMD: --bind 0.0.0.0 --dir /data --maxmemory-policy allkeys-lru --protected-mode no

Troubleshooting

IssueCauseSolution
Connection refusedKV not running or wrong portCheck kv-server is running, verify port
OOMmaxmemory reachedSet --maxmemory and --maxmemory-policy
Persistence issuesAOF corruptionRun kv-check-aof --fix
ZAP module not loadingMissing .so fileBuild with cd modules/zap && make
